Reserve Bin A Chardonnay has evolved into a wine that is now a distinctive, single-region style, with a contemporary and expressive Adelaide Hills Chardonnay persona. Fruit is hand-picked into small bins and then whole-bunch pressed. A portion of the juice is allowed to undergo a natural fermentation, sans inoculation. Every new and seasoned French oak barrique is its own unique 225-litre ferment. Enhanced mouthfeel and complexity is achieved by fermenting and maturing on solids with regular yeast lees stirring (bâttonage). 100% malolactic fermentation (all natural).

Penfolds is one of Australia’s most recognised and respected wine producers, with a winemaking heritage that stretches back to 1844. Founded by Dr. Christopher and Mary Penfold in South Australia, the estate quickly earned a reputation for quality and innovation. Over the years, Penfolds has perfected the art of blending fruit from the best vineyard regions across the country, creating wines that are rich, balanced, and unmistakably Australian. From everyday favourites to the world-famous Grange, Penfolds offers something for every wine lover. Each bottle reflects the brand’s commitment to craftsmanship and consistency, whether it’s a smooth Shiraz, a vibrant Cabernet Sauvignon, or a crisp Chardonnay. With over 175 years of expertise, Penfolds continues to set the standard for premium Australian wine – a name you can trust for both special occasions and simple pleasures alike.
